COMPLETED: East Martindale Road and Frederick Pike Watermain Extension Project

A public waterline was extended to the Aullwood Audubon Center and Farm.

TRAFFIC IMPACT:

There are no remaining traffic impacts related to this project work. Please drive carefully.

CONSTRUCTION TIMING:

This project is completed.

COST:

$3 million

COMMUNITY BENEFIT: Ensuring local residents and businesses have access to clean and safe drinking water is one of the highest priorities a local municipality holds. The East Martindale Road and Frederick Pike Watermain Extension Project provided public water access to the Aullwood Audubon Center and Farm.

DETAILED SCOPE: The project extended a public waterline to the Aullwood Audubon Center and Farm. It included the extension of a 12” watermain from East Martindale Road to Frederick Pike, along Frederick Pike and under US 40 to Aullwood, allowing residents who wished to tie into the public water system the ability to do so.
